The future of aviation is rapidly advancing through innovations in electric propulsion, vertical takeoff and landing (VTOL) capabilities, autonomous flight systems, and sustainable technologies. Modern aircraft designs are evolving from traditional configurations to include V-shaped wings, ring-wing structures, and distributed electric propulsion systems that improve efficiency and reduce environmental impact. These advancements enable new possibilities for urban air mobility, regional connectivity, and personal flight, with applications ranging from electric VTOL vehicles for city transportation to hybrid electric aircraft for business travel and cargo delivery. The integration of smart flight systems, battery technology, and advanced materials is transforming aviation into a more accessible, efficient, and sustainable mode of transportation.

The Flying V is a futuristic aircraft concept that introduces a completely different approach to airplane design.
Instead of using a traditional fuselage, it combines the passenger area, cargo space, and fuel storage directly into its wide V-shaped wings. This unique structure helps reduce weight and improve aerodynamic performance. Despite its compact appearance, the aircraft is designed to carry a similar number of passengers and cargo as an Airbus A350 while potentially using around 20% less fuel. The design is also planned to work with current airport systems, making future adoption more practical. In 2020, a successful first flight of a scaled prototype demonstrated the potential of this innovative concept. The flying V represents ongoing efforts to create more efficient and sustainable aircraft for the future of commercial aviation.
Rise recon is a personal electric V aircraft created for people who want a simple and direct way to experience flight. Developed by Rise Aero Technologies, this singleseat aircraft is designed to make flying more accessible with controls that feel familiar even for beginners. The Recon uses six separate electric motors and multiple propellers placed around a lightweight structure to provide balanced lift and improved reliability.
In the United States, it falls under the ultralight category, allowing recreational use in certain situations with proper guidance and training. It is expected to reach speeds of around 101 km per hour and uses removable battery packs for flexible short flights.
Featuring an open cockpit, joystick controls, and optional waterlanding floats, the Recon brings a drone inspired flying experience closer to everyday personal transportation.

Electra E9 is a hybrid electric aircraft designed to improve short distance and regional air travel. Built for short takeoff and landing operations, this aircraft combines electric propulsion with a turbine powered generator to deliver efficient performance and greater flexibility. Its advanced design allows it to operate from very small landing areas, including locations where conventional aircraft may not be practical. The EL9 can transport up to nine passengers with baggage or carry around 3,000 lb of cargo, making it useful for both passenger flights and logistics operations. It is expected to cruise at nearly 175 knots with a standard range of about 330 nautical miles, while extended ferry operations can increase its range to around 1,100 nautical miles. By combining efficient flight technology with access to smaller airfields, the Electra Eal9 aims to improve regional connectivity and transportation options.

Honda Jet Elite is an advanced very light jet that focuses on improving comfort, performance, and efficiency in private aviation. Its unique over-the-wing engine placement helps reduce cabin noise while improving aerodynamic performance. The aircraft is powered by 2G Honda HF120 turboan engines providing strong cruising capability with a maximum speed of around 422 knots. It can reach flight levels up to 43,000 ft and offers a range of approximately 1,437 nautical miles with four passengers. The Honda Jet Elite can operate from shorter runways requiring about 3,499 ft for takeoff. Inside, the pressurized cabin can accommodate up to seven passengers and features modern Garmin G3000 avionics with advanced flight assistance systems. Combining luxury efficiency and smart technology, the Honda Jet Elite provides a practical solution for personal and business travel. VOLXplane is an advanced aircraft project being developed by DARPA to explore the future of vertical flight technology. The goal of this program is to combine the advantages of helicopters and traditional airplanes into one versatile platform. This aircraft is designed to perform vertical takeoffs and hover in place like a helicopter while also achieving much higher speeds during forward flight. The V22 style concepts aim for sustained speeds between 300 and 400 knots, which would be a major improvement over many existing VTOL aircraft. Engineers are also focusing on improving hover efficiency to around 75% while maintaining a useful payload capacity.
With an estimated gross weight between 10,000 and 12,000 lb, the project represents a major step toward creating faster and more efficient vertical takeoff aircraft for future missions.

The C5 Super Galaxy is one of the largest military transport aircraft ever built. Designed to move massive equipment and support missions around the world. Introduced in the 1970s by Loheed Martin, this aircraft was created to carry extremely heavy and oversized cargo that many other transport planes cannot handle. With a payload capacity of more than 120 tons, the C5 can transport military vehicles, helicopters, and other essential equipment across long distances.
Its unique front and rear cargo doors allow for faster loading and unloading, improving operational flexibility. The aircraft also features advanced avionics and a large internal cargo area, allowing it to complete long range missions with fewer stops. Combining huge capacity, global reach, and reliable performance, the C5 Super Galaxy remains a key asset in strategic air transportation.

Loheed has developed a concept aircraft known as the Ring-wing plane. Designed with a single continuous wing loop instead of traditional separate wings, this circular wing structure gives the aircraft a distinctive appearance and is intended to improve efficiency in flight. The wing measures about 7.4 m in circumference and curves back at an angle of roughly 27° connecting toward the tail section. The aircraft itself is large, standing around 23 m tall. But the design is not just for appearance.
The ring shape helps produce more lift and reduces the impact of crosswinds during flight. This could lead to lower fuel consumption and more stable performance in challenging weather conditions, making it an interesting idea for future aviation development. The Pagio P180 Ivanti is a distinctive executive aircraft recognized for its advanced design and strong performance.
It combines the speed often associated with light jets while maintaining the fuel efficiency of a turborop. Designed for private owners, charter operators, and government missions, it offers a practical balance of comfort and performance. One of its defining features is the three surface aerodynamic layout, which includes a small front wing, a main wing positioned farther back, and a rear tat tail. This unique configuration helps reduce drag, improve stability, and increase overall efficiency. Rear-mounted pusher propellers further enhance aerodynamic performance while keeping cabin noise lower for a quieter journey. Inside, the pressurized cabin comfortably seats up to nine passengers, creating a pleasant environment for business or personal travel.

The Manta A&2, often called Manta 2, is a hybrid electric EV aircraft built for flexibility, efficiency, and practical use. It is designed to cruise at around 300 km per hour and can travel up to 1,000 km in standard flight conditions. The aircraft carries two people in a tandem seating layout. Its structure uses lightweight carbon composite materials combined with a Vtail and forward canard wings to improve aerodynamic performance. The propulsion system features eight ducted fans with four fixed units and four that can tilt for vertical and forward flight. A hybrid power system blends onboard generators with batteries, allowing it to operate using sustainable aviation fuel. The aircraft supports both vertical takeoff and short runway operations, making it suitable for tight or remote locations. Safety features include flybywire controls, a heads up display system, and a ballistic parachute. Its modular build also allows easier transport, maintenance, and mission flexibility.
The J2000 flying car is an innovative concept developed by Jet Optera.
Designed to combine speed and vertical flight in a compact air vehicle, it is built for vertical takeoff and landing and can reach speeds of up to 200 mph.
With an estimated range of around 200 m, it could be used for longer trips or future air taxi services. What makes the J2000 different is its propulsion method. Instead of traditional propellers, it uses a fluidic propulsion system inspired by bladeless fan technology. This system pushes compressed air through surrounding air flow to create thrust. The design includes four ring-shaped thrusters with two positioned at the front and two at the rear. Once in flight, the front units can fold into the body while the rear ones provide forward movement. This approach aims to improve efficiency, reduce noise, and lower overall weight compared to conventional VTOL aircraft.

The Solo 262502i Neo Silent represents a modern step forward in aircraft engine design, showing how propulsion technology is becoming more efficient and refined.
Developed for ultralight aircraft and powered gliders, this engine focuses on delivering strong performance while keeping weight to a minimum. It uses a twin cylinder liquid cooled two-stroke layout combined with electronic fuel injection. This setup allows smoother operation and better fuel efficiency compared to older engine systems. In addition, dual high voltage electronic ignition improves reliability and helps maintain consistent performance during flight. The engine is compact and lightweight, making it suitable for aircraft where weight plays a critical role. Its design also aims to reduce vibration and noise, creating a more comfortable flying experience for pilots. Overall, the Solo 262502i Neo Silent reflects the direction of modern aviation where quieter operation, improved efficiency, and dependable performance are becoming key priorities in engine development.
The Aryan AS2 was a supersonic business jet project developed with the goal of making highspeed international travel more practical. It was designed to reach speeds of up to Mach 1.6, allowing routes like New York to London to be completed in around 4 hours. The aircraft used advanced aerodynamic shaping, including a low drag delta style wing and an area ruled fuselage, both aimed at improving air flow efficiency and reducing resistance during flight. It was planned to have a range of about 4,750 nautical miles, giving it strong long-d distanceance capability. Although the company behind the project stopped operations in 2021, the AS2 still represents an important step in supersonic aviation development, it helped demonstrate how faster and more efficient passenger travel could be achieved in the future and continues to influence research in next generation aircraft, including experimental projects focused on quieter supersonic flight.

The Aerommobile 5.0 is a next generation flying car developed by the Slovak company Aerommobile. Designed for door-to-door travel, it can carry up to four passengers and operates on electric power. Its unique propulsion system combines a rear pusher propeller for forward flight with two electric propellers mounted on the wing tips for vertical takeoff and landing. When driving on roads, the wings fold back, allowing it to function like a conventional car. The vehicle also includes advanced safety features such as airbags and a full aircraft parachute for added protection. On a single charge, it can cover up to 435 mi, providing flexibility for both urban commutes and longer intercity trips.
Aerommobile envisions a future with fully autonomous flight for this model.
Aiming to simplify personal air travel while maintaining versatility by combining the convenience of a car with the efficiency of an aircraft, the Aerommobile 5.0 offers a practical solution for seamless multimodal transportation.

The Vertical VX4 is an advanced electric vertical takeoff and landing aircraft developed for modern urban transportation. Built to improve short distance air travel, the aircraft combines efficiency, quiet performance, and advanced safety systems in a compact design. It can carry four passengers along with one pilot, making it suitable for fast city to city trips and regional urban mobility services. The VX4 reaches cruising speeds of around 150 km per hour and is designed for routes of approximately 40 km. Its electric propulsion system uses a four-rotor setup supported by redundant twin engine technology to improve reliability during flight operations. Another key feature is its extremely low noise level operating at under 60 dB which makes it more suitable for populated urban environments. The aircraft also includes a modern digital flight control system that assists pilots with smooth handling and precise maneuverability. The Rolls-Royce EVOL concept is a hybrid electric aircraft designed for several transportation roles, including personal travel, public mobility, cargo delivery, and military operations. The aircraft combines electric propulsion with gas turbine technology to create a quieter and more efficient flying system for future air transportation. Its hybrid setup uses a gas turbine engine to generate electricity, which powers six electric propellers. This design helps reduce cabin noise while improving overall energy efficiency during flight.
The aircraft is expected to travel distances of around 500 m while reaching speeds close to 250 mph.
Inside, the cabin is designed to carry four to five passengers comfortably. For vertical takeoff and landing, the wings rotate up to 90°, allowing the aircraft to lift off without a runway.
The Volonaut airbike is a compact personal flying vehicle designed to combine the feeling of riding a motorcycle with the ability to fly.
Developed by Polish inventor Tomas Patton, the aircraft focuses on lightweight construction and simple flight control for personal aerial mobility. Built with carbon fiber materials and 3D printed parts, the airbike weighs only around 66 lb, making it far lighter than a typical motorcycle. Instead of exposed propellers, it uses a jet propulsion system that allows a clear 360° field of view during flight. The vehicle is capable of reaching speeds close to 124 mph while maintaining a compact and streamlined design. Its onboard stabilization technology and flight computer assist with hovering and balance, helping make operation smoother and easier for new users. The airbike can run on diesel, biodeiesel, jet A1 fuel, or kerosene. And the refueling process takes less than a minute.
